As we begin 2025, World Bible School is blessed to welcome two new members to our team. We are always encouraged when God connects us to people that bring in fresh talent and experience, and who are eager to put their unique gifts to work at WBS.

Our Support department was thrilled to add Travena Rogan, from Lebanon, Tennessee as a Support Associate at the start of the year. Travena has a strong background in customer service, working primarily in the healthcare industry, and we are looking forward to having her share her skills and knowledge with WBS. She also speaks at Christian women’s events across the country.

Regarding her new role, Travena writes, “Perfect is not what I seek to be, but a follower of Jesus is where my footsteps will be. I’ve prayed periodically to be able to work in ministry and God has tremendously blessed me. I am humbly excited to be a part of the Support Team and further the Kingdom through WBS.”

In more good news, Joshua Cook joined WBS in early February as a Regional Advancement Representative for his home state of Tennessee, where he lives in Rockvale. With a master’s degree in Ministry from Freed-Hardeman University, Josh has served as a minister in multiple congregations of the Lord’s church throughout Tennessee, and he is ready to continue his path with WBS.

Josh shares, “What an honor it is to serve World Bible School and to offer congregations the means to advance God’s kingdom on earth. The future of Christianity is indeed bright, beloved. For my part, I’m truly excited to support this visionary organization as it continues to shine the Gospel light in such an attractive, effective, and inviting way.”

We are grateful for the opportunity to grow our team here at WBS, and know that God has great plans in store for both Travena and Josh in 2025.
